Target Priority

With the help of the Target Priority technology, if you’re measuring multiple items that are seemingly layered on top of each other, your rangefinder will prioritize the closest object, giving you accurate measurements.

Multiple Target Measuring

With the help of the integrated continuous scanning mode, you’ll have eight seconds of continuous measurements so you can get an idea of how far away multiple targets are.

What’s to like about the Nikon Coolshot 20

Lightweight and compact design

If you’ve ever had the ability to use a Nikon rangefinder before, you’re aware of how large they can typically be. Fortunately, with the design of the Nikon Coolshot 20, the manufacturers were able to create something that is far more lightweight and easy to store while you’re on the green.

Easy for everyone to use

No matter if you’ve never owned a rangefinder before or if you’re a professional golfer, the Nikon Coolshot 20 is comfortable to use on a daily basis. All you have to do is look through the viewfinder, press the button once your pin has been targeted, and read the measurements.

A carrying case is included

Some people might think that additional accessories aren’t necessary, but with golfing rangefinders, you’re going to need some type of protection to keep your investment safe. Luckily, the Nikon Coolshot 20 comes with a carrying case.

What’s not to like about the Nikon Coolshot 20

Difficult to stabilize

It’s important to remember that the more lightweight a device is, the more difficult it will be to keep steady. In this case, you may have to use two hands in an effort to measure targets at a distance, as the Nikon Coolshot 20 doesn’t seem to have an integrated stabilizer.

Difficult to pick up pins

Another issue that you may have with this rangefinder is its difficulty with differentiating your pin from other background items, such as trees. This can lead to inaccurate findings or needing to measure the same target several times.

Pinsensor Technology

When it comes to getting measurements, you’ll love the integration of the Pinsensor Technology which is designed to give you incredibly fast accuracy and the ability to measure subjects that might be layered on top of one another. You’ll truly be able to experience this elevated type of measuring if you’re golfing in wooded areas or around hazards.

Lens Display

Another great advantage of this particular golf rangefinder is that it offers lens display or through the lens display. This allows you to easily read measurements as well as check the battery meter to help make using it far simpler.

Laser Measuring

There’s nothing more precise than being able to measure between point A and B with the help of a laser. The laser measuring gives you the ability to track things up to 540 yards away from your person.

What’s to like about the TecTecTec VPRO500

Automatically shuts off

One of the greatest advantages to the TecTecTec VPRO500 is it has a feature that automatically powers the unit down if you forget to turn it off after taking measurements. This allows you to spend more time golfing and less time dealing with technology.

Simple to operate

If you’re not the type of person who likes to spend a lot of time fooling around with advanced features, the TecTecTec VPRO500 is exactly what you’ve been looking for. All you need to do is select the appropriate measuring mode, point, and shoot.

What’s not to like about the TecTecTec VPRO500

Needs to be held steadily

If there’s one thing that makes using this rangefinder particularly difficult it’s that it needs to be held extremely steady in order to get accurate measurements. For people with jittery hands, it might not be the right rangefinder with you.

Difficult to find pins

As a result of there not being a stabilizer integrated into the design, the TecTecTec VPRO500 makes it quite difficult to find and focus on pins, especially if they are over 150 yards away.

FINAL VERDICT

Both the Nikon Coolshot 20 and the TecTecTec vpro500 have a lot to offer. Both have excellent user feedback, are extremely easy to use and come at a reasonable price point. I don’t think you could go wrong with either rangefinder. However, on balance, I’d say that the Nikon Coolshot just edges it for me. You get the brand quality that comes with Nikon who are the renowned top quality camera manufacturers and who have been involved in making optical devices for over 100 years. The Nikon is easy to use, fits snuggly in the palm of your hand and for the price point, I’d say it has the best optics in its class.
